Exploring In-Context Learning Capabilities of ChatGPT for Pathological Speech Detection

Abstract

Automatic pathological speech detection approaches have shown promising results, gaining attention as potential diagnostic tools alongside costly traditional methods. While these approaches can achieve high accuracy, their lack of interpretability limits their applicability in clinical practice. In this paper, we investigate the use of multimodal Large Language Models (LLMs), specifically ChatGPT-4o, for automatic pathological speech detection in a few-shot in-context learning setting. Experimental results show that this approach not only delivers promising performance but also provides explanations for its decisions, enhancing model interpretability. To further understand its effectiveness, we conduct an ablation study to analyze the impact of different factors, such as input type and system prompts, on the final results. Our findings highlight the potential of multimodal LLMs for further exploration and advancement in automatic pathological speech detection.
